| 34 | /** This node class is used to build singly-linked lists. */ |
| 35 | class ListNode { |
| 36 | |
| 37 | private: |
| 38 | |
| 39 | ListNode* mNext; |
| 40 | void* mData; |
| 41 | |
| 42 | public: |
| 43 | |
| 44 | ListNode* next() { return mNext; } |
| 45 | void next(ListNode* wNext) { mNext=wNext; } |
| 46 | |
| 47 | void* data() { return mData; } |
| 48 | void data(void* wData) { mData=wData; } |
| 49 | }; |
| 50 | |
| 51 | |
| 52 | |
| 53 | |
| 54 | /** A fast FIFO for pointer-based storage. */ |
| 55 | class PointerFIFO { |
| 56 | |
| 57 | private: |
| 58 | |
| 59 | ListNode* mHead; ///< points to next item out |
| 60 | ListNode* mTail; ///< points to last item in |
| 61 | ListNode* mFreeList; ///< pool of previously-allocated nodes |
| 62 | unsigned mSize; ///< number of items in the FIFO |
| 63 | |
| 64 | public: |
| 65 | |
| 66 | PointerFIFO() |
| 67 | :mHead(NULL),mTail(NULL),mFreeList(NULL), |
| 68 | mSize(0) |
| 69 | {} |
| 70 | |
| 71 | unsigned size() const { return mSize; } |
| 72 | |
| 73 | /** Put an item into the FIFO. */ |
| 74 | void put(void* val); |
| 75 | |
| 76 | /** |
| 77 | Take an item from the FIFO. |
| 78 | Returns NULL for empty list. |
| 79 | */ |
| 80 | void* get(); |
| 81 | |
| 82 | |
| 83 | private: |
| 84 | |
| 85 | /** Allocate a new node to extend the FIFO. */ |
| 86 | ListNode *allocate(); |
| 87 | |
| 88 | /** Release a node to the free pool after removal from the FIFO. */ |
| 89 | void release(ListNode* wNode); |
| 90 | |
| 91 | }; |
